From 0e2d98bc17d4f3b80926f9a86006010ea6907a74 Mon Sep 17 00:00:00 2001 From: Chong Lu Date: Wed, 16 Jul 2014 16:52:05 +0800 Subject: diffstat: update to version 1.59 Remove unneeded patches, since they're included in new version. Signed-off-by: Chong Lu Signed-off-by: Saul Wold Signed-off-by: Richard Purdie --- .../diffstat/diffstat/aclocal-popen.patch | 20 ------------ .../diffstat/diffstat/aclocal.patch | 38 ---------------------- .../diffstat/diffstat/dirfix.patch | 27 --------------- meta/recipes-devtools/diffstat/diffstat_1.58.bb | 33 ------------------- meta/recipes-devtools/diffstat/diffstat_1.59.bb | 30 +++++++++++++++++ 5 files changed, 30 insertions(+), 118 deletions(-) delete mode 100644 meta/recipes-devtools/diffstat/diffstat/aclocal-popen.patch delete mode 100644 meta/recipes-devtools/diffstat/diffstat/aclocal.patch delete mode 100644 meta/recipes-devtools/diffstat/diffstat/dirfix.patch delete mode 100644 meta/recipes-devtools/diffstat/diffstat_1.58.bb create mode 100644 meta/recipes-devtools/diffstat/diffstat_1.59.bb diff --git a/meta/recipes-devtools/diffstat/diffstat/aclocal-popen.patch b/meta/recipes-devtools/diffstat/diffstat/aclocal-popen.patch deleted file mode 100644 index d95561bc48..0000000000 --- a/meta/recipes-devtools/diffstat/diffstat/aclocal-popen.patch +++ /dev/null @@ -1,20 +0,0 @@ -Add a description to the HAVE_POPEN_PROTOTYPE AC_DEFINE so that this define is -included in config.h. - -Upstream-Status: Submitted (via email) -Signed-off-by: Ross Burton - - -diff --git a/aclocal.m4 b/aclocal.m4 -index 3f20573..ec5ca51 100644 ---- a/aclocal.m4 -+++ b/aclocal.m4 -@@ -931,7 +931,7 @@ ac_cv_td_popen=no, - ac_cv_td_popen=yes)) - AC_MSG_RESULT($ac_cv_td_popen) - if test $ac_cv_td_popen = yes; then -- AC_DEFINE(HAVE_POPEN_PROTOTYPE) -+ AC_DEFINE(HAVE_POPEN_PROTOTYPE,[1],[Conflicting popen prototype]) - fi - ])dnl - dnl --------------------------------------------------------------------------- diff --git a/meta/recipes-devtools/diffstat/diffstat/aclocal.patch b/meta/recipes-devtools/diffstat/diffstat/aclocal.patch deleted file mode 100644 index cde4a4050b..0000000000 --- a/meta/recipes-devtools/diffstat/diffstat/aclocal.patch +++ /dev/null @@ -1,38 +0,0 @@ -Use the correct macro name (AC_AUTOCONF_VERSION) in the CF_ACVERSION_CHECK macro. -The original macro name (AC_ACVERSION) leads to this error: - -| autoreconf: running: aclocal --system-acdir=/poky/buildnew/tmp/work/i586-poky-linux/diffstat/1.57-r0/build/aclocal-copy/ --automake-acdir=/poky/buildnew/tmp/sysroots/x86_64-linux/usr/share/aclocal-1.12 --force -| aclocal: warning: autoconf input should be named 'configure.ac', not 'configure.in' -| configure.in:9: error: m4_defn: undefined macro: AC_ACVERSION -| acinclude.m4:989: CF_PROG_CC is expanded from... -| configure.in:9: the top level -| autom4te: m4 failed with exit status: 1 - -Upstream-Status: Submitted (via email) -Signed-off-by: Bogdan Marinescu - -Index: diffstat-1.58/aclocal.m4 -=================================================================== ---- diffstat-1.58.orig/aclocal.m4 2013-10-29 01:43:23.000000000 +0200 -+++ diffstat-1.58/aclocal.m4 2013-11-04 11:22:53.461562567 +0200 -@@ -13,16 +13,16 @@ - dnl Conditionally generate script according to whether we're using a given autoconf. - dnl - dnl $1 = version to compare against --dnl $2 = code to use if AC_ACVERSION is at least as high as $1. --dnl $3 = code to use if AC_ACVERSION is older than $1. -+dnl $2 = code to use if AC_AUTOCONF_VERSION is at least as high as $1. -+dnl $3 = code to use if AC_AUTOCONF_VERSION is older than $1. - define([CF_ACVERSION_CHECK], - [ - ifdef([AC_ACVERSION], ,[m4_copy([m4_PACKAGE_VERSION],[AC_ACVERSION])])dnl - ifdef([m4_version_compare], --[m4_if(m4_version_compare(m4_defn([AC_ACVERSION]), [$1]), -1, [$3], [$2])], -+[m4_if(m4_version_compare(m4_defn([AC_AUTOCONF_VERSION]), [$1]), -1, [$3], [$2])], - [CF_ACVERSION_COMPARE( - AC_PREREQ_CANON(AC_PREREQ_SPLIT([$1])), --AC_PREREQ_CANON(AC_PREREQ_SPLIT(AC_ACVERSION)), AC_ACVERSION, [$2], [$3])])])dnl -+AC_PREREQ_CANON(AC_PREREQ_SPLIT(AC_AUTOCONF_VERSION)), AC_AUTOCONF_VERSION, [$2], [$3])])])dnl - dnl --------------------------------------------------------------------------- - dnl CF_ACVERSION_COMPARE version: 3 updated: 2012/10/03 18:39:53 - dnl -------------------- diff --git a/meta/recipes-devtools/diffstat/diffstat/dirfix.patch b/meta/recipes-devtools/diffstat/diffstat/dirfix.patch deleted file mode 100644 index 15dbf2b778..0000000000 --- a/meta/recipes-devtools/diffstat/diffstat/dirfix.patch +++ /dev/null @@ -1,27 +0,0 @@ -$libdir isn't used by the Makefile at all apart from in this mkdir. -This will be used without any DESTDIR so if your libdir is a different -layout to the bulid system it will cause a failure. E.g: - -Build system has /usr/lib only -libdir = /usr/lib64 for the target -Results in "mkdir: cannot create directory `/usr/lib64': Permission denied" - -Since the directory is never used, we can just remove the mkdir. - -Upstream-Status: Submitted (via email) - -RP 23/9/2011 - -Index: diffstat-1.54/makefile.in -=================================================================== ---- diffstat-1.54.orig/makefile.in 2011-09-22 19:13:11.330158571 +0100 -+++ diffstat-1.54/makefile.in 2011-09-22 19:13:35.610158363 +0100 -@@ -79,7 +79,7 @@ - $(INSTALL_DATA) $(srcdir)/$(THIS).1 $(man1dir)/$(THIS).$(manext) - - installdirs : -- mkdir -p $(BINDIR) $(libdir) $(man1dir) -+ mkdir -p $(BINDIR) $(man1dir) - - uninstall : - rm -f $(BINDIR)/$(PROG) $(man1dir)/$(THIS).$(manext) diff --git a/meta/recipes-devtools/diffstat/diffstat_1.58.bb b/meta/recipes-devtools/diffstat/diffstat_1.58.bb deleted file mode 100644 index 15fb4231c8..0000000000 --- a/meta/recipes-devtools/diffstat/diffstat_1.58.bb +++ /dev/null @@ -1,33 +0,0 @@ -SUMMARY = "Tool to produce a statistics based on a diff" -DESCRIPTION = "diffstat reads the output of diff and displays a histogram of \ -the insertions, deletions, and modifications per-file. It is useful for \ -reviewing large, complex patch files." -HOMEPAGE = "http://invisible-island.net/diffstat/" -SECTION = "devel" -LICENSE = "MIT" -LIC_FILES_CHKSUM = "file://install-sh;endline=42;md5=b3549726c1022bee09c174c72a0ca4a5" - -SRC_URI = "ftp://invisible-island.net/diffstat/diffstat-${PV}.tgz \ - file://dirfix.patch \ - file://aclocal.patch \ - file://aclocal-popen.patch \ - file://run-ptest \ -" - -SRC_URI[md5sum] = "6d6e13f7dcfe4db5da65c5175260ea47" -SRC_URI[sha256sum] = "fad5135199c3b9aea132c5d45874248f4ce0ff35f61abb8d03c3b90258713793" - -S = "${WORKDIR}/diffstat-${PV}" - -inherit autotools gettext ptest - -do_configure () { - if [ ! -e ${S}/acinclude.m4 ]; then - mv ${S}/aclocal.m4 ${S}/acinclude.m4 - fi - autotools_do_configure -} - -do_install_ptest() { - cp -r ${S}/testing ${D}${PTEST_PATH} -} diff --git a/meta/recipes-devtools/diffstat/diffstat_1.59.bb b/meta/recipes-devtools/diffstat/diffstat_1.59.bb new file mode 100644 index 0000000000..f599622b3e --- /dev/null +++ b/meta/recipes-devtools/diffstat/diffstat_1.59.bb @@ -0,0 +1,30 @@ +SUMMARY = "Tool to produce a statistics based on a diff" +DESCRIPTION = "diffstat reads the output of diff and displays a histogram of \ +the insertions, deletions, and modifications per-file. It is useful for \ +reviewing large, complex patch files." +HOMEPAGE = "http://invisible-island.net/diffstat/" +SECTION = "devel" +LICENSE = "MIT" +LIC_FILES_CHKSUM = "file://install-sh;endline=42;md5=b3549726c1022bee09c174c72a0ca4a5" + +SRC_URI = "ftp://invisible-island.net/diffstat/diffstat-${PV}.tgz \ + file://run-ptest \ +" + +SRC_URI[md5sum] = "1dc7bc48ce846a0686a1af0d091ff8fb" +SRC_URI[sha256sum] = "267d1441b8889cbefbb7ca7dfd4a17f6c8bc73bc114904c74ecad945a3dbf270" + +S = "${WORKDIR}/diffstat-${PV}" + +inherit autotools gettext ptest + +do_configure () { + if [ ! -e ${S}/acinclude.m4 ]; then + mv ${S}/aclocal.m4 ${S}/acinclude.m4 + fi + autotools_do_configure +} + +do_install_ptest() { + cp -r ${S}/testing ${D}${PTEST_PATH} +} -- cgit 1.2.3-korg